gnunet-svn
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[GNUnet-SVN] r14066 - gnunet/src/core


From: gnunet
Subject: [GNUnet-SVN] r14066 - gnunet/src/core
Date: Thu, 23 Dec 2010 23:07:17 +0100

Author: grothoff
Date: 2010-12-23 23:07:17 +0100 (Thu, 23 Dec 2010)
New Revision: 14066

Modified:
   gnunet/src/core/gnunet-service-core.c
Log:
better stats

Modified: gnunet/src/core/gnunet-service-core.c
===================================================================
--- gnunet/src/core/gnunet-service-core.c       2010-12-23 22:01:53 UTC (rev 
14065)
+++ gnunet/src/core/gnunet-service-core.c       2010-12-23 22:07:17 UTC (rev 
14066)
@@ -2944,10 +2944,16 @@
                  "Core received `%s' request for `%4s', already connected!\n",
                  "REQUEST_CONNECT",
                  GNUNET_i2s (&cm->peer));
-      GNUNET_STATISTICS_update (stats, 
-                               gettext_noop ("# connection requests ignored 
(already connected)"), 
-                               1,
-                               GNUNET_NO);
+      if (GNUNET_YES == n->is_connected) 
+       GNUNET_STATISTICS_update (stats, 
+                                 gettext_noop ("# connection requests ignored 
(already connected)"), 
+                                 1,
+                                 GNUNET_NO);
+      else
+       GNUNET_STATISTICS_update (stats, 
+                                 gettext_noop ("# connection requests ignored 
(already trying)"), 
+                                 1,
+                                 GNUNET_NO);
       return; /* already connected, or at least trying */
     }
   GNUNET_STATISTICS_update (stats, 
@@ -4170,7 +4176,10 @@
           GNUNET_break_op (0);
           return;
         }
-      GNUNET_STATISTICS_update (stats, gettext_noop ("# session keys 
received"), 1, GNUNET_NO);
+      GNUNET_STATISTICS_update (stats,
+                               gettext_noop ("# session keys received"), 
+                               1, 
+                               GNUNET_NO);
       handle_set_key (n,
                      (const struct SetKeyMessage *) message,
                      ats, ats_count);




reply via email to

[Prev in Thread] Current Thread [Next in Thread]